Phase 5: News Writing Fundamentals In basic, newspaper article are organized using the upside down pyramid style, in which info is provided in coming down order of value. This allows the audience to check out one of the most essential details swiftly so they can make a decision whether to continue or quit reviewing the story. From an editing and enhancing point of view, utilizing the inverted pyramid style makes it much easier to reduce a story from the base, if required.

At Storyful, we work with eyewitnesses daily locating their tales on the social web and sharing them with information companies around the world. To do this properly, we have to reveal some empathy when connecting and speaking with uploaders, considering what they have actually simply experienced, be it humorous or traumatic.


This is hardly a brand-new development. In 1963, Abraham Zapruder was the co-owner of a ladies's apparel company when he recorded what is probably among one of the most most popular eyewitness video clips of perpetuity: the assassination of Head of state John F. Kennedy. According to reports, Zapruder was traumatised by what he saw that day for several years to come.
